英文摘要 | Abstract Based on the principle and characteristics of the zero-flux Hall current sensor, traditional Hall current sensors mostly use analog drive circuits, which have low output power, poor anti-interference ability and are inconvenient to debug. Aiming at the disadvantages of traditional sensors, a method based on the composition and technical realization of a digital drive system with DSP as the core is given. DSP is used as the main controller which combined with CPLD to realize the distribution of information. The hardware circuit of the drive system is designed that includes operational amplifier circuit, DSP processing circuit, optocoupler circuit and power amplifier circuit. Also, the system application software is designed and it includes the DSP program of the main control board, the CPLD information distribution program and the upper computer application software. Through analyzing the waveforms and data of the experimental test, the results show that the designed sensor digital drive system has good uncertainty, linearity, and anti-interference. All indicators have reached the design requirements and have a wide range of practicability. |
